Decades of research has shown that student’s development is rooted in their relationships. Having caring, positive relationships with parents, teachers, mentors, coaches, and peers, increases the likelihood that young people develop resilience in the face of adversity, promotes growth-mindset, and helps them to develop social-emotional learning skills needed to succeed at school & thrive in life.
However, the same research has been instrumental in exposing that about 40 percent of young people feel lonely. Our studies and those of others also show that socioeconomic equity gaps increase and that academic motivation declines as studen ts progress from elementary school through high school.
So what does this mean? Essentially, this means that the task of preparing our young people for the future is not just for educators. If we want to see our children thrive and grow with a positive outlook on life and the future, we all have work to do.
